public class JsonUtils extends Object
| Modifier and Type | Method and Description |
|---|---|
static com.google.gson.JsonElement |
deepCopy(com.google.gson.JsonElement from)
Copies all the property values from the supplied
JsonElement. |
static <T> T |
fromJsonTree(com.google.gson.TypeAdapter<T> typeAdapter,
com.google.gson.stream.JsonReader originalReader,
com.google.gson.JsonElement element) |
static com.google.gson.JsonElement |
toJsonTree(com.google.gson.TypeAdapter typeAdapter,
com.google.gson.stream.JsonWriter optionsFrom,
Object value) |
public static com.google.gson.JsonElement deepCopy(com.google.gson.JsonElement from)
JsonElement. This method is similar to
JsonElement.deepCopy(). We are not using JsonElement.deepCopy() because it is not publicfrom - public static com.google.gson.JsonElement toJsonTree(com.google.gson.TypeAdapter typeAdapter,
com.google.gson.stream.JsonWriter optionsFrom,
Object value)
throws IOException
IOExceptionpublic static <T> T fromJsonTree(com.google.gson.TypeAdapter<T> typeAdapter,
com.google.gson.stream.JsonReader originalReader,
com.google.gson.JsonElement element)
throws IOException
IOExceptionCopyright © 2018. All rights reserved.